Program Overview – Community Care
This position reports to the Supervisor of the Transportation Program and is responsible for providing safe, reliable, and professional transportation services to seniors and adults with disabilities within the community.
The incumbent reports to the Supervisor, Transportation of the Transportation Programs, and is responsible for carrying out assigned duties in a manner that ensures the safety and well-being of clients and the public, while safeguarding WoodGreen’s property and reputation.

What You Will Do
  • Provide safe, timely, door-to-door or door-through-door transportation services to clients.
  • Assist clients with boarding and exiting vehicles, including the safe operation of wheelchair lifts, ramps, securement systems, and seatbelts.
  • Support clients using mobility aids, including wheelchairs, walkers, and scooters.
  • Provide assistance with the distribution of meals as required under the Meals on Wheels program.
  • Conduct pre- and post-trip vehicle inspections and promptly report any maintenance or safety concerns.
  • Maintain accurate, mileage logs, and complete incident reports as required.
  • Comply with all Ministry of Transportation regulations and WoodGreen policies and procedures.
  • Maintain client confidentiality in accordance with applicable privacy legislation, including PHIPA.
  • Follow infection prevention and control protocols, including vehicle cleanliness and sanitation standards.
  • Communicate effectively and professionally with schedulers, supervisors, clients, caregivers, and WoodGreen/Toronto Ride staff.
  • Respond appropriately to emergencies, including contacting emergency services and notifying supervisors as required.
  • Participate in mandatory training sessions, team meetings, and continuous quality improvement initiatives.
  • Support and uphold the organization’s anti-racism objectives, equity commitments, and community development principles within the program.
  • Perform other related duties as assigned from time to time.
